Transaction ec60f292b8661c7f7d453af8b548f705929ea385ba4acb4745b28ab90e7f1c43
1 Input
1 Output
-
ec60f292b8661c7f7d453af8b548f705929ea385ba4acb4745b28ab90e7f1c43:0
- value
- 880524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1feaceaf65ea9fec25db699cd8edadcdbcd5e855 OP_EQUAL
- address
- 34bnAC6fCMWKyeRGb8rjv8dcyQBUEVpv7e